Chilled Beams
Chilled beams are designed to simultaneously ventilate, cool, and/or heat indoor spaces. The main advantages of chilled beam systems are the great thermal comfort level, silent operation, low operating cost, resulting in an efficient, optimal indoor climate. OptimAir
Two-way active chilled beam for false ceiling applications
Description and function
OptimAir is a water- and air-borne induction unit with bidirectional air diffusion, recommended for commercial applications such as office buildings, shopping malls, retail stores, restaurants, and hotels, where a combination of ventilation, cooling, and/or heating is required. OptimAir is designed primarily for false ceiling installations but can be supplied with an optional Coanda frame for visible mounting. The unit is available with two plenum alternatives for Small (S) or Large (L) airflows and a high-capacity heat exchanger option to best suit the cooling and/or heating demand of the conditioned space.
For added flexibility, OptimAir can be supplied with adjustable nozzles, enabling adjustments of the primary airflow even after installation. The nozzles are thoughtfully positioned above the heat exchanger to maximize the coil’s effect and optimally mix the primary supply air with the induced room air. This results in a well-conditioned space, providing consistent cooling across the room while focusing on the thermal and acoustic comfort of the occupants. For additional flexibility and efficiency, OptimAir can be equipped with our latest generation CA-CB on-board digital controller developed for DCV (Demand-Controlled Ventilation) requirements.
Because water is a more effective medium for heat transfer compared to air, chilled beams are an outstanding energy-efficient solution, reducing the overall energy needed for cooling, heating, and ventilation. FacadeAir
Induction unit for supply air, cooling and heating
Description
FacadeAir is an induction unit for supply air, cooling and heating, intended for installation along a perimeter wall. With the primary air stream as the driving force, the room air is induced through the heat exchanger, that in consequence cools or heats the air. The primary and induced airflow is supplied to room through the window bench grille, towards the ceiling. The circular plenum box for the supply airflow is equipped with fixed nozzles and predetermined airflows. The unit can be shipped with three optional air spigot dimensions: 125, 160 or 200. FacadeAir is delivered with a wall mounted rack and a pipe console for the water pipes.
